Artela Network Logo/Homepage

Artela is an advanced layer 1 network aimed at high performance with a "next-generation" execution layer. On August 23rd, the team reported that their Discord server was breached, and a fake airdrop was run. No details on the specific airdrop promotion could be found, nor does it appear that any users have reported being affected. The team reportedly dealt with the matter quickly and restored their Discord channel.[1][2][3][4][5][6][7]

About Artela Network

"Artela is an extensible L1 blockchain with parallel execution and modular VMs. With key innovation of EVM++, Artela enables modular, customizable, and scalable dApps."

"The Artela Blockchain is an advanced Layer 1 (L1) network that enables developers to implement user-defined native extensions and develop high-performance decentralized applications (dApps). It surpasses EVM-equivalence with superior extensibility and inter-domain interoperability. Featuring an innovative elastic block space design, Artela ensures boundless scalability, allowing applications to scale seamlessly with demand, optimizing performance and development flexibility."

"At the core of Artela's technological advancements is EVM++ - the next-generation Ethereum Virtual Machine (EVM) execution layer. EVM++ enhances blockchain extensibility by facilitating on-chain native extensions through the innovative EVM + Aspect approach. Additionally, it supports parallel execution, which significantly contributes to blockchain scalability. This dual capability ensures that Artela not only extends functionality but also optimizes performance for diverse blockchain applications."

Key Event Timeline - Artela Discord Compromise Fake Airdrop
Date Event Description
August 23rd, 2024 8:43:00 PM MDT Post Made On Twitter The Artela team posts on Twitter to notify their community about the Discord take-over. The community is advised to make sure they are using the correct links. At this time, they note that they have full control over the server and the perpetrator was found and dealt with quickly.
August 23rd, 2024 11:38:00 PM MDT CoinLive Article Posted CoinLive posts an article about the fake airdrop.
August 24th, 2024 1:00:00 AM MDT CoinNess Global Post CoinNess Global posts a tweet about the incident.

Immediate Reactions

"The parallel-execution EVM public chain Artela announced on the X platform that their official Discord was hacked today. The attacker took control of the Discord channel and spread fake airdrop messages. The team took immediate action, removed the fraudulent posts, and the Discord has now been restored."

"Fraud Alert for Artela Community Make sure you're using the correct links"

Our Discord was hacked today, affecting channel settings and spreading false airdrop news. We’ve taken immediate action to remove the fraudulent posts and the hacker’s account. We have full control of the server and the perpetrator was found quickly and dealt with."

"Beware of Fake Airdrops: Artela has no ongoing airdrop. Do not click on suspicious links or connect your wallet to unverified sites.

Stay safe and report security issues in our new Discord channel community-security.

As we approach the mainnet launch, expect more hack attempts. We’re enhancing security and urge everyone to remain vigilant.

Together, we keep Artela secure!"
